    I finally checked out this place after driving by it on numerous occasions. They offer a variety of…read morefresh local vegetables, fruits, organic vegetables/fruits, potted plants, flowers, potted orchids, and grocery items. I was impressed by their large variety of vegetables including Asian veggies, & some I hadn't even seen before. Their prices are reasonable and look decent. I bought a watermelon which I would avoid. It was mushy on the inside. It's not only at this place but I found it to be the same everywhere. It's because it's overripe. They are located right across from the Richmond Nature Park with free parking out front. They even have shopping carts to lighten the load. A bonus! The place was clean and service was okay. A great place to grab that missing ingredient to create a meal or buy flowers for a special occasion. It's rare to find a market that sells a lot of local produce & fruit. All I can say is support local farmers and businesses!

    Searching on Yelp while staying at Richmond area, I was excited to visit Richmond Public Market, a…read moreno-frills, old-school Asian market + food court, this public market does need some renovations, could tell that this is the original public market, the parking is available but keep in mind stalls are narrow. The washrooms are available ( thank goodness) but not in the greatest condition. There are 2 levels to Richmond's Public Market, The ground floor has the market of fresh produce, seafood, meats, herbs, gifts, electronics, flowers, set up like a Chinese outdoor market . Although I never get to check out the ground level during both visit since we were here early and not open yet. But my favorite is the 2nd level, this is where the foodies will reunite, the food court, So many Asian foodies selection, from Szechuan, Taiwanese, noodles, dumplings, boba tea, even Vietnamese too, there's too many to list. The reason I made a stop here twice was for Hei Hei rice rolls, which I am pretty sure If you know, you know. I grab from 2 other shops here. Tables were provided which I was able to enjoy our rice rolls and also got take out for later. * cash only, since credit cards are not accepted, we used the ATM to take out some cash/CAD but the fees were ridiculous, better to be prepared next time and exchange $$ upon arrival to Richmond, BC. Great nostalgic place (30+ years) to visit, don't judge by the looks of it. Now extended hours and open until 8:00 pm!
